Context & Ripple Effects

The gap between official and real-world connectivity has been widening for years: research in Missouri and Virginia found ~38% of rural homes the FCC counted as having broadband actually lacked it, and the agency moved ahead with a $16B rural plan even while conceding its coverage data lacked granularity. Microsoft's ~120 million figure — versus BroadbandNow's 42 million with no access at all — is the sharpest statement yet of how far the official map understates the problem.

Against that backdrop, the Bloomberg piece lands on states like Arkansas weighing a menu of fixes — CBRS, Elon Musk's Starlink, 5G home internet — while local telcos wrestle with trenching costs and equipment damage, and fiber-first proponents argue that anything less than fiber repeats past mistakes just as the US commits $64.5B+ that may still not cover the cost of laying fiber.

First-order effects

  • Arkansas's local telcos face an immediate fork: absorb high trenching costs and signal problems to reach underserved homes, or cede those households to wireless alternatives like Starlink and 5G home internet that need no trenches.
  • Microsoft's 120M estimate puts pressure on FCC coverage maps and ISP-reported data, strengthening the case from fiber-first proponents who argue subsidies should fund only future-proof builds.

Second-order effects

  • Starlink and 5G home internet providers gain a subsidized market opening wherever fiber economics fail, forcing state broadband offices to choose per-household between wired and wireless technologies rather than defaulting to fiber everywhere.
  • Criticism that Biden's rural-first strategy leaves 13.6M urban households behind sharpens into a funding-allocation fight, as urban gaps become harder to justify ignoring once the true national shortfall is measured at 120 million.

Third-order effects

  • With an earlier analysis showing 50%+ of Rural Digital Opportunity Fund areas were already covered by prior broadband programs, repeated overlap pushes policy toward usage-verified coverage data and technology-neutral awards rather than map-based grants.
  • If fiber's cost and labor constraints persist across the $64.5B effort, US broadband structurally bifurcates into fiber where density allows and satellite/wireless elsewhere — entrenching two classes of 'high-speed' access.

The trend: US broadband policy is shifting from FCC-map-driven funding toward a multi-technology race — fiber, CBRS, Starlink, and 5G home internet competing for the same underserved households — because independent measurements keep showing the official gap is far smaller than the real one.
